CEO Roundtable Drives the Formation of a Cohesive Leadership Team

Reported Year
2021
Sarah Laroque became president and CEO of EarthBalance without much experience running a business. She was unsure what to expect from being CEO and how she could best overcome the challenges that brought, like leading the team and putting the right people in the right places.
